    This review is to refresh my review of 5 years ago. Not much has changed since then and that's good. This place serves breakfast but I always come for lunch. The blue plate special for $7.99 (includes drink) served Sunday thru Friday is what you probably want. After paying at the counter you go down a short cafeteria line and pick from one of 3 daily meat offerings and then select 2 of the 4-5 vegetable options. You also get a dessert or a 3rd veggie if you wish. With a bread choice and a drink you have a full meal and it tastes soooo good! For the money you can't beat it and it is only offered during lunchtime. If for some reason that doesn't appeal to or you come on a Saturday or for dinner any day, I really like their Jumbo Burger combo with onion rings. The burger has a 1/3 lb. patty and is well dressed on a big bun. It is a solidly good tasting hamburger. The onion rings are some of the best I have eaten and cooked in a batter with a pepper slant that is delicious. They have a Super Jumbo burger with a 2/3 lb. patty too. I am a fan of this place. You will be too.

    This was a must stop at place for my mom and I. We learned about Pearl's Diner from the show…read moreHometown and knew we had to visit once coming to Laurel. It is only open for lunch from 11-2pm Tuesday through Saturday. We made sure we got in line a few minutes before 11am. Yes a line, so get there early. The doors opened right at 11am and you order from the counter and have a seat. The staff is welcoming and assist with the line and seating to have everything move smoothly. The prices were not bad at all and we got alot of food. The fried chicken is out of this world. A must get. You won't regret it. It is so flavorful with crispy skin, yet moist chicken. Also, it is not super greasy which was my favorite part. I enjoyed the green beans and corn on the cob. The jalapeño corn bread was amazing! My mom got the black eyed peas, mac n cheese, and regular cornbread with her fried chicken. She raved about the black eyes peas. We also ordered banana pudding and Mrs. Pearl's Cheesecake. The banana pudding was my favorite and a great sweet treat to round out my southern meal. The inside of the diner is not very large but does have plenty of seating inside and some outside. While we did not see Mrs. Pearl, her sister greeted us and was definitely running the diner while we were there.
